Output 0d88f25cc60a9981339cc36a4e8111e0fca8dbda0b39d7ebf667c3ad9ee6146c:8

value
29935638
script pubkey
OP_0 OP_PUSHBYTES_20 63c58891b8b4e34b014300f8c7dcacfd90f2999c
address
ltc1qv0zc3ydckn35kq2rqruv0h9vlkg09xvu78qfg4
transaction
0d88f25cc60a9981339cc36a4e8111e0fca8dbda0b39d7ebf667c3ad9ee6146c
spent
true